/**
|
|
* Provider Expiration Tracking
|
|
*
|
|
* Tracks OAuth token, subscription, and API credit expiration dates
|
|
* per provider connection. Provides proactive alerts before expiration
|
|
* so operators can re-authenticate or renew before failures occur.
|
|
*
|
|
* Prevents the common failure mode where an OAuth token or subscription
|
|
* expires silently and requests start failing with 401/402 errors.
|
|
*/
|
|
|
|
/** Types of expiration events */
|
|
export type ExpiryType = "oauth_token" | "subscription" | "api_credits" | "free_tier_reset";
|
|
|
|
/** Status derived from expiration date */
|
|
export type ExpiryStatus = "active" | "expiring_soon" | "expired" | "unknown";
|
|
|
|
/** Tracked expiration for a provider connection */
|
|
export interface ProviderExpiration {
|
|
/** Connection ID (matches ProviderConnection.id) */
|
|
connectionId: string;
|
|
/** Provider name (e.g., "claude", "codex", "antigravity") */
|
|
provider: string;
|
|
/** Human-readable connection name */
|
|
connectionName: string;
|
|
/** ISO date when the credential expires (null = unknown) */
|
|
expiresAt: string | null;
|
|
/** Type of expiration */
|
|
expiryType: ExpiryType;
|
|
/** Days before expiry to trigger alert (default: 7) */
|
|
alertDays: number;
|
|
/** ISO date of last verification */
|
|
lastChecked: string;
|
|
/** Current status */
|
|
status: ExpiryStatus;
|
|
/** Optional note (e.g., "Membership expired, needs re-auth on dashboard") */
|
|
note: string | null;
|
|
}
|
|
|
|
/** Summary of provider expiration health */
|
|
export interface ExpirationSummary {
|
|
total: number;
|
|
active: number;
|
|
expiringSoon: number;
|
|
expired: number;
|
|
unknown: number;
|
|
nextExpiration: ProviderExpiration | null;
|
|
}
|
|
|
|
// ── In-memory store ──────────────────────────────────────────────────────────
|
|
// In production, this would be persisted to SQLite alongside other domain state.
|
|
// Using in-memory Map for the initial implementation.
|
|
|
|
const expirations = new Map<string, ProviderExpiration>();
|
|
|
|
/**
|
|
* Calculate expiry status from an expiration date.
|
|
*/
|
|
function calculateStatus(expiresAt: string | null, alertDays: number): ExpiryStatus {
|
|
if (!expiresAt) return "unknown";
|
|
|
|
const now = new Date();
|
|
const expiry = new Date(expiresAt);
|
|
|
|
if (isNaN(expiry.getTime())) return "unknown";
|
|
if (expiry <= now) return "expired";
|
|
|
|
const daysUntilExpiry = (expiry.getTime() - now.getTime()) / (1000 * 60 * 60 * 24);
|
|
if (daysUntilExpiry <= alertDays) return "expiring_soon";
|
|
|
|
return "active";
|
|
}
|
|
|
|
/**
|
|
* Register or update an expiration tracking entry.
|
|
*/
|
|
export function setExpiration(
|
|
connectionId: string,
|
|
provider: string,
|
|
connectionName: string,
|
|
expiresAt: string | null,
|
|
expiryType: ExpiryType,
|
|
options?: { alertDays?: number; note?: string | null }
|
|
): ProviderExpiration {
|
|
const alertDays = options?.alertDays ?? 7;
|
|
const status = calculateStatus(expiresAt, alertDays);
|
|
|
|
const entry: ProviderExpiration = {
|
|
connectionId,
|
|
provider,
|
|
connectionName,
|
|
expiresAt,
|
|
expiryType,
|
|
alertDays,
|
|
lastChecked: new Date().toISOString(),
|
|
status,
|
|
note: options?.note ?? null,
|
|
};
|
|
|
|
expirations.set(connectionId, entry);
|
|
return entry;
|
|
}
|
|
|
|
/**
|
|
* Get expiration info for a specific connection.
|
|
*/
|
|
export function getExpiration(connectionId: string): ProviderExpiration | null {
|
|
const entry = expirations.get(connectionId);
|
|
if (!entry) return null;
|
|
|
|
// Recalculate status (may have changed since last check)
|
|
entry.status = calculateStatus(entry.expiresAt, entry.alertDays);
|
|
return entry;
|
|
}
|
|
|
|
/**
|
|
* Get all tracked expirations, with status recalculated.
|
|
*/
|
|
export function getAllExpirations(): ProviderExpiration[] {
|
|
const result: ProviderExpiration[] = [];
|
|
for (const entry of expirations.values()) {
|
|
entry.status = calculateStatus(entry.expiresAt, entry.alertDays);
|
|
result.push(entry);
|
|
}
|
|
return result.sort((a, b) => {
|
|
// Sort: expired first, then expiring_soon, then active, then unknown
|
|
const order: Record<ExpiryStatus, number> = {
|
|
expired: 0,
|
|
expiring_soon: 1,
|
|
active: 2,
|
|
unknown: 3,
|
|
};
|
|
return (order[a.status] ?? 4) - (order[b.status] ?? 4);
|
|
});
|
|
}
|
|
|
|
/**
|
|
* Get connections that are expired or expiring soon.
|
|
*/
|
|
export function getExpiringSoon(): ProviderExpiration[] {
|
|
return getAllExpirations().filter((e) => e.status === "expired" || e.status === "expiring_soon");
|
|
}
|
|
|
|
/**
|
|
* Get a summary of expiration health across all tracked connections.
|
|
*/
|
|
export function getExpirationSummary(): ExpirationSummary {
|
|
const all = getAllExpirations();
|
|
|
|
const summary: ExpirationSummary = {
|
|
total: all.length,
|
|
active: 0,
|
|
expiringSoon: 0,
|
|
expired: 0,
|
|
unknown: 0,
|
|
nextExpiration: null,
|
|
};
|
|
|
|
let nearestMs = Infinity;
|
|
|
|
for (const entry of all) {
|
|
switch (entry.status) {
|
|
case "active":
|
|
summary.active++;
|
|
break;
|
|
case "expiring_soon":
|
|
summary.expiringSoon++;
|
|
break;
|
|
case "expired":
|
|
summary.expired++;
|
|
break;
|
|
case "unknown":
|
|
summary.unknown++;
|
|
break;
|
|
}
|
|
|
|
// Track nearest expiration
|
|
if (entry.expiresAt) {
|
|
const ms = new Date(entry.expiresAt).getTime() - Date.now();
|
|
if (ms > 0 && ms < nearestMs) {
|
|
nearestMs = ms;
|
|
summary.nextExpiration = entry;
|
|
}
|
|
}
|
|
}
|
|
|
|
return summary;
|
|
}
|
|
|
|
/**
|
|
* Remove expiration tracking for a connection.
|
|
*/
|
|
export function removeExpiration(connectionId: string): boolean {
|
|
return expirations.delete(connectionId);
|
|
}
|
|
|
|
/**
|
|
* Try to detect expiration hints from HTTP response headers.
|
|
* Many providers include rate limit reset times that can indicate
|
|
* quota or token expiration.
|
|
*
|
|
* @param provider - Provider ID
|
|
* @param status - HTTP status code
|
|
* @param headers - Response headers (as plain object)
|
|
* @returns Detected expiration date or null
|
|
*/
|
|
export function detectExpirationFromResponse(
|
|
provider: string,
|
|
status: number,
|
|
headers: Record<string, string>
|
|
): { expiresAt: string; expiryType: ExpiryType } | null {
|
|
// 401 with specific patterns → token expired
|
|
if (status === 401) {
|
|
return {
|
|
expiresAt: new Date().toISOString(), // Already expired
|
|
expiryType: "oauth_token",
|
|
};
|
|
}
|
|
|
|
// 402 → payment/subscription expired
|
|
if (status === 402) {
|
|
return {
|
|
expiresAt: new Date().toISOString(),
|
|
expiryType: "subscription",
|
|
};
|
|
}
|
|
|
|
// Rate limit headers may indicate reset times
|
|
const resetHeader =
|
|
headers["x-ratelimit-reset"] || headers["x-ratelimit-reset-tokens"] || headers["retry-after"];
|
|
|
|
if (resetHeader && status === 429) {
|
|
const resetTime = parseInt(resetHeader, 10);
|
|
if (!isNaN(resetTime)) {
|
|
// Could be epoch seconds or seconds-from-now
|
|
const date =
|
|
resetTime > 1_000_000_000
|
|
? new Date(resetTime * 1000)
|
|
: new Date(Date.now() + resetTime * 1000);
|
|
return {
|
|
expiresAt: date.toISOString(),
|
|
expiryType: "free_tier_reset",
|
|
};
|
|
}
|
|
}
|
|
|
|
return null;
|
|
}
|
|
|
|
/**
|
|
* Reset all tracked expirations. Useful for testing.
|
|
*/
|
|
export function resetExpirations(): void {
|
|
expirations.clear();
|
|
}
